A varmepumpe, or heat pump, operates by transferring heat from a single location to a different employing electric power. It could possibly extract heat in the air (luft til luft), ground (jordvarme), or h2o (luft til vand) depending on the type of technique. For this guideline, We are going to focus on luft til vand varmepumper, which extract heat from the outside air and transfer it to the drinking water-dependent heating system inside the house.

### Arranging and Planning

#### Evaluating Your preferences
Prior to putting in a varmepumpe, assess your heating and very hot water wants. Take into consideration variables such as:

- **Size of Your private home:** The square footage and insulation degree impression the heating requirements.
- **Latest Heating Program:** Assess the performance and age of one's current heating process.
- **Hot H2o Need:** Determine If you'd like the varmepumpe to deliver hot water Along with heating.

#### Site Assessment
Select an acceptable site to the varmepumpe unit. Contemplate the following:

- **Outdoor Unit Locale:** Assure suitable House and good airflow within the unit for optimum effectiveness.
- **Indoor Device Spot:** Allocate Room for your indoor parts similar to the water tank and distribution system.
- **Accessibility:** Assure both equally units are simply available for maintenance and repairs.

#### Electrical and Plumbing Concerns
Confirm that your electrical technique can aid the varmepumpe's power requirements. For luft til vand varmepumper, plumbing connections in between the warmth pump and the drinking water-primarily based heating procedure are crucial. Make certain pipes are insulated appropriately to circumvent heat loss.

### Installation Approach

#### Out of doors Unit Installation
Setting up the outside unit requires various steps:

1. **Foundation Preparing:** Assure a stable, amount foundation for your varmepumpe device.
two. **Mounting the Unit:** Securely mount the out of doors luft til vand varmepumpe device, guaranteeing it really is level and secure.
3. **Connecting Refrigerant Lines:** Join the refrigerant strains among the out of doors and indoor units, making certain correct insulation to avoid heat reduction.

#### Indoor Device Installation
The indoor installation usually contains:

one. **H2o Tank Set up:** Set up the drinking water tank or integrate the varmepumpe with your present hot h2o program.
two. **Connecting to Heating Process:** Join the varmepumpe to your heating method (underfloor heating, radiators, and many others.) utilizing suitable plumbing connections.
3. **Electrical Connections:** Guarantee all electrical connections are created In keeping with nearby codes and producer technical specs.

#### Commissioning and Tests
Following installation, the process really should be commissioned and analyzed:

1. **Procedure Checks:** Perform complete checks to make sure all elements are functioning appropriately.
2. **Efficiency Tests:** Take a look at the varmepumpe's heating capability and incredibly hot water output to confirm performance.

### Routine maintenance and Treatment

#### Frequent Maintenance
To make certain exceptional functionality and longevity of your varmepumpe:

- **Standard Inspections:** Agenda once-a-year inspections by a qualified technician to check refrigerant concentrations, electrical connections, and Total system efficiency.
- **Filter Cleansing:** Clean or change filters often to take care of airflow and efficiency.
- **Observe Efficiency:** Keep track of Power consumption and heating efficiency to detect any possible issues early.

#### Troubleshooting Common Issues
Be aware of common varmepumpe concerns for instance refrigerant leaks, compressor complications, or sensor malfunctions. Addressing these instantly can protect against much larger complications and assure ongoing operation.
